** code courtesy of Christophe Fergeau **
* src/itdb_itunesdb.c (mk_mhbd): write extended header needed for new iPod Nanos (3G Video) and iPod Classics. src/itdb_device.c src/itdb_device.h: Code to parse SysInfoExtended and SysInfo for the FireWireGUID. You must either copy the iPod description XML file to Device/SysInfoExtended or add a line 'FirewireGuid: 000A27....' to Device/SysInfo. You can get your FirewireGuid by using the tests/test-fw-id test program. * src/sha1.c src/sha1.h src/itdb_sha1.c src/itdb_sha1.h New files for obscure hash generation code. * src/Makefile.am: added new files. * tests/test-checksum.c tests/test-fw-id.c tests/Makefile.am: test programs to retrieve the FirewireGuid and calculate/write the obscure hash. git-svn-id: https://gtkpod.svn.sf.net/svnroot/gtkpod/libgpod/trunk@1698 f01d2545-417e-4e96-918e-98f8d0dbbcb6
